俄亥俄共和党人提议, 要求照片ID副本 与邮寄选票, 引起对选民访问的担忧。
Ohio Republicans propose requiring photo ID copies with mail-in ballots, sparking concern over voter access.
俄亥俄共和党人提出了众议院第577号法案,要求邮寄选票的投票者附上一张有照片的身份证副本,目的是使邮件投票与面对面投票规则保持一致。
Ohio Republicans introduced House Bill 577, requiring mail-in ballot returners to include a photo ID copy, aiming to align mail-in voting with in-person rules.
该法案由众议员罗恩·弗格森 (Ron Ferguson) 于 2025 年 11 月 5 日提出,要求在申请站点免费复印,但面临选举倡导者的批评,他们表示俄亥俄州的选举已经安全,并警告说该规则可能会剥夺老年人、残疾人和其他获得复印服务的机会有限的人的权利。
The bill, introduced November 5, 2025, by Rep. Ron Ferguson, mandates free photocopying at application sites but faces criticism from election advocates who say Ohio’s elections are already secure and warn the rule could disenfranchise seniors, people with disabilities, and others with limited access to copying services.
该法案已提交给委员会,但尚未安排听证。
The bill has been referred to committee but has not yet been scheduled for a hearing.
